Materials and Methods Antibodies and reagents Unless stated normally, all reagents were from Sigma. Stock solutions of CCCP (carbonyl cyanide m-chloro phenyl hydrazone; C2759; 10 mM), antimycin A (A8674; 1 mg/ml in ethanol), anisomycin (A9789; 5 mg/ml), staurosporine Elastase Inhibitor (S4400; 1 mM), DAPI (4, 6-diamidino-2-phenylindole; D9542; 1 mg/ml), proteinase K (P6556; 10 mg/ml), puromycin (P7255; 10 mg/ml) were stored at -20C. The following primary antibodies were used: anti-myc (9E10; M4439); anti-HSP60 (H4149); anti-actin (Santa Cruz Biotechnology, sc-1616); anti-PARP (Calbiochem, AM30); anti-GFP for immunoblotting (Covance, MMS-118R); anti-GFP for immunoEM (Rockland, 600-401-215); anti-Tom20 (BD Biosciences, 612278); anti-OPA1 (BD Biosciences, 612607); anti-tubulin (Sigma, T5168). Secondary antibodies for immunoblotting (HRP-tagged) were from Jackson Immunochemicals (mouse, 715-035-150; rabbit, 711-035-152, goat: 705-035-147); for immunofluorescence were from Molecular Probes (anti-mouse Alexa 594, A-11032); for immunoEM were from Aurion (6 nm platinum; 806.011). HeLa cell tradition and transient transfection HeLa cells were managed in DMEM supplemented with 10% fetal bovine serum, at 37C and 5% CO2. Cells were transfected using Genejuice (Novagen, 70967) according to the manufacturers instructions. Lentiviral cloning Domains of Atg4D were PCR amplified and put in framework into pEGFP or pEYFP plasmids (Clontech). Full-length and caspase-truncated Atg4D were put into pcDNA3.1 myc/his (Invitrogen, V800-20). Lentiviruses were generated by digestion of the relevant pEGFP (-C1) constructs (wild-type and C144A N63 Atg4D-GFP; 64-105 Atg4D-GFP) using the restriction enzymes Afe1 and BamH1, followed by sub-cloning into pLVX-Puro vector (Clontech, 632164). Viruses were produced in HEK293T cells according to the manufacturers instructions (Lenti-XTM HTX packaging system; Clontech, 631247) and they were used to infect HeLa cells. Selection of stable clones was performed by addition of puromycin (1 g/ml). Lentiviruses were produced by cotransfection of the pxlg3 constructs in HEK 293T cells as explained previously.46 Erythroid cell differentiation and lentiviral transformation Peripheral, human blood cells were isolated from waste buffy-coat material or from waste apheresis cones from anonymous blood and platelet donors (National Blood Solutions, Bristol, UK); a provision that complies with the Nuffield Council on Bioethics Guidance on Human being Cells Honest and Legal Issues 1954, the Medical Study Councils Operational and Honest Guidance on Human being Cells and Biological Samples for use in Study 2005 and the Royal College of Pathologists Transitional Recommendations to facilitate changes in methods for handling surplus and archival material from human biological samples. Samples were diluted 1:1 with Hanks balanced salt remedy (HBSS, H6648) and layered on Histopaque-1077 (H8889). Mononuclear cells were harvested from your gradient, washed with HBSS and reddish blood cells were lysed in lysis buffer [150 mM ammonium chloride, 1 mM K2EDTA.2 H2O, 10 mM potassium bicarbonate buffer (pH 7.5)]. CD34+ cells were then isolated using the Direct CD34+ Progenitor Cell Isolation kit (Miltenyi Biotech Ltd., 130-046-072) relating to manufacturers instructions. Isolated CD34+ cells were cultured using a revised two-stage system.28,29 They were first cultured for up to 10 d in Elastase Inhibitor serum-free Stemspan media (Stem Cell Systems, 09650) supplemented with Stem Cell Element (SCF; 10 ng/ml; R&D Systems, 255-SC), IL-3 (1ng/ml; R&D Systems, 203-IL), EPO (3 UI/ml; Roche, NeoRecormon), bovine lipoprotein (1 l/l; L4646) and Prograf (0.1 ng/ml; Fujisawa).
